From 2018-2022, I was a full-time teacher at a Title I high school. Courses taught included Intro to Biology, Medical Biology, Zoology, and AP Biology. I led and developed Next Generation Science Standards-aligned inquiry-based curriculum across grade levels. During this time, I also participated in the NSF teacher research program, where I conducted research at the University of California Riverside and used the findings to build a data-driven learning unit. As a faculty member, I served on the advisory board for the HEAL medical pathway, was the faculty advisor for the National Honor Society, and was the founder and advisor of the Intersectional Feminists Club.
